Chemical Properties of Bases

(1) They liberate ammonia gas when react with ammonium salt.

2NH4 CL(ag) CaCL2(ag) 2NH3(g)+ 2H2O(L)

(2) They react with acids to form salt and water.

NaOH(aq) + HCL(ag) NaCL + H2O
